Key Insights

  • πŸŽ’ Organizing GoPro gear in one pack with labeled compartments enhances efficiency.
  • πŸ—ΊοΈ Traveling with multiple cameras provides backup options and creative versatility.
  • 🚡 Various accessories like mounts, chargers, and adapters are essential for capturing diverse shots.
  • 🎴 Using a clear card wallet for micro SD cards and adapters prevents losing important gear.
  • 🀯 Chest mounts, head mounts, and extenders like the x-shot offer unique shooting angles.
  • 🚠 Investing in cable management solutions keeps charging cables and accessories organized.
  • ⏲️ A simple egg timer can be used for time-lapse shots with GoPro cameras.

Questions & Answers

Q: How does Chase Jarvis recommend organizing GoPro gear?

Chase suggests keeping all like items together in labeled compartments to enhance organization and efficiency while on the go. This method ensures easy access and quick setup for any adventure.

Q: Why does Chase travel with multiple GoPro cameras?

Chase travels with multiple GoPro cameras to have backup options and versatility in capturing shots from different angles. Having three cameras allows for more creative freedom and ensures no missed shots during filming.

Q: What are some alternative accessories Chase recommends for GoPro cameras?

Chase recommends accessories like chest mounts, roll bar mounts, head mounts, and the x-shot extender for capturing unique and dynamic shots in various environments. These accessories provide flexibility in shooting styles and angles.

Q: How does Chase ensure he doesn't lose important gear like micro SD cards?

Chase uses a think tank wallet to store micro SD cards and adapters, ensuring they are easily accessible and safe from getting lost. This method helps him stay organized and ready for any filming situation.
